Zappa is a 2020 American documentary film about American musician Frank Zappa.[1]

Reception[edit]

On review aggregator website Rotten Tomatoes, the film holds an approval rating of 96% based on 71 reviews, with an average rating of 7.6/10. The website's consensus reads: "As rich and complex as its subject's best work, Zappa honors the life and career of a musical legend without falling into hagiography."[2]
